Understanding the Mechanics of Predictive Markets

Predictive markets, at their core, function much like traditional financial markets, but instead of trading stocks or commodities, participants trade contracts that pay out based on the outcome of a future event. The price of a contract fluctuates based on supply and demand, reflecting the collective belief of traders regarding the probability of that event occurring. A key characteristic is their self-correcting nature; as new information emerges, the market price adjusts, incorporating the latest insights. This constant recalibration leads to increasingly accurate predictions, often surpassing the performance of traditional forecasting methods. This dynamic pricing is what incentivizes accurate predictions; those who believe an event is more likely than the market suggests will buy contracts, expecting to profit when the event occurs and the contract value increases.

The regulatory framework governing these markets is crucial. Unlike unregulated betting platforms, platforms like Kalshi operate under the oversight of the Commodity Futures Trading Commission (CFTC) in the United States, ensuring a level of fairness and transparency. This oversight also provides safeguards against manipulation and fraud, building trust among participants. The contracts offered on these platforms cover a wide range of events, from political elections and economic indicators to natural disasters and even the outcomes of sporting events. The diversity of contracts allows traders to diversify their portfolios and explore different areas of prediction.

The Role of Incentive Structures

Effective predictive markets depend on strong incentive structures. Participants are motivated by the potential for financial gain – correctly predicting outcomes leads to profits, while incorrect predictions result in losses. However, the incentive isn't solely financial. Many traders are motivated by the challenge of accurately forecasting events and honing their analytical skills. This intellectual curiosity adds another layer to the market’s dynamics. Furthermore, well-designed markets encourage information sharing, as traders benefit from incorporating insights from others to improve their predictions. This collaborative aspect distinguishes predictive markets from simple gambling or speculation.

The liquidity of the market is also a critical factor. Higher liquidity means it’s easier to buy and sell contracts without significantly impacting the price, creating a more efficient marketplace. Platforms with a large number of active traders typically exhibit greater liquidity, making them more attractive to participants. Efficient market makers also play a role in ensuring liquidity by providing consistent buy and sell orders, narrowing the bid-ask spread and facilitating smoother trading.

The Advantages of Using Prediction Markets

Compared to traditional methods of forecasting, prediction markets offer several compelling advantages. Their decentralized nature allows them to tap into a wider range of perspectives, reducing the risk of groupthink. The financial incentives inherent in the system encourage participants to invest time and effort in analyzing available information, resulting in more informed predictions. Furthermore, the real-time feedback provided by market prices allows for continuous learning and refinement of forecasting models. These markets can also act as early warning systems, identifying potential risks or opportunities before they become widely apparent through conventional channels.

Another key benefit is their ability to aggregate information from diverse sources. Traditional forecasting often relies on limited data sets and expert opinions, whereas prediction markets incorporate the collective knowledge of a large and varied group of participants. This aggregation effect can lead to more accurate and robust predictions, particularly in complex situations where numerous factors are at play. The dynamic nature of these markets also allows them to adapt quickly to changing circumstances, making them more resilient to unforeseen events. This responsiveness is a significant advantage over static forecasting models.

Challenges and Considerations for Adoption

Despite their potential, predictive markets face several challenges that hinder widespread adoption. Regulatory hurdles can be significant, particularly in jurisdictions where gambling laws are restrictive. Ensuring market integrity and preventing manipulation are also crucial concerns. Attracting enough participants to achieve sufficient liquidity can also be a challenge, particularly for niche markets. Educating the public about the benefits of predictive markets and overcoming skepticism are essential for fostering broader acceptance.

Furthermore, the design of the market itself is critical. Contracts must be clearly defined, and the payout structure must be fair and transparent. The market platform must be user-friendly and accessible to a wide range of participants. Addressing these challenges requires a collaborative effort between regulators, market operators, and participants, furthering the development of this innovative technology.
